First off, let’s talk timelines. Unlike hyaluronic acid fillers that plump instantly, PLLA works by stimulating collagen production over weeks. Clinical studies show measurable changes starting at 4-6 weeks, with 80% of patients reporting visible skin thickening and texture improvement by month three. One 2022 trial published in *Aesthetic Surgery Journal* tracked 150 participants using 3D imaging – their average mid-face volume increased by 18% after two treatments spaced six weeks apart. But here’s the kicker: these results kept improving for up to 12 months post-treatment as collagen rebuilt structural support.

But wait – if results take months, why do clinics push PLLA? The answer lies in its dual-phase action. Immediately after injection, PLLA microparticles (typically 40-63 microns in size) create subtle volume through water absorption. This initial “hydration boost” smooths fine lines by 15-20% within days, a clever biological placeholder while collagen ramps up production. Now, skeptics might ask: “If PLLA’s so great, why isn’t everyone ditching Botox?” The truth? It’s about muscle vs. structure. Botox paralyzes muscles (smoothing existing wrinkles in 3-7 days), while PLLA rebuilds collagen (preventing new wrinkles). They’re complementary – a 2021 Harvard study found combining both increased patient satisfaction scores by 41% compared to either treatment alone. As for safety, PLLA’s track record speaks volumes: a 2019 review of 10,000+ cases showed only 5-10% experienced temporary nodules, mostly when practitioners used outdated dilution techniques.
